Understanding Your Needs First
Before diving into plan comparisons, it’s essential to assess your personal healthcare needs. Consider:

  • Your current health: Do you have chronic conditions requiring frequent doctor visits or specialized care?
  • Your prescription medications: Do you take multiple prescriptions? How much do they cost?
  • Your preferred doctors/hospitals: Do you want to keep your current providers?
  • Your budget: How much can you comfortably spend on premiums, deductibles, and copayments?
  • Travel: Do you plan to travel extensively within the U.S. or internationally?

Comparing Major Medicare Plan Types
The core of choosing a Medicare plan involves understanding the fundamental differences between Original Medicare, Medicare Advantage, and Medigap, along with the necessity of Part D for prescription drugs.

  • Original Medicare (Part A & Part B) + Part D + Medigap: This combination offers the most flexibility in choosing doctors and hospitals nationwide who accept Medicare. Medigap plans significantly reduce your out-of-pocket costs from Original Medicare, and a separate Medicare Part D plan covers prescriptions.   • Medicare Advantage (Part C) Plans: These plans bundle your Part A, Part B, and often Part D benefits into a single plan. They may include additional benefits like dental, vision, and hearing care. While they often have lower (or even $0) monthly premiums, they typically have network restrictions (HMOs or PPOs) and fixed copayments for services. Key Factors for Comparison:
When evaluating plans, we guide you through critical elements:

  • Premiums: The monthly cost you pay for the plan.
  • Deductibles: The amount you must pay before your plan starts to pay.
  • Copayments/Coinsurance: Your share of the cost for services after the deductible is met.
  • Out-of-Pocket Maximum: The most you’ll have to pay for covered services in a year (exclusive to Medicare Advantage).
  • Formulary: The list of covered drugs for Part D plans. We compare Medicare Part D plans based on your specific prescription needs.
  • Provider Network: Whether your preferred doctors and hospitals are included in the plan’s network.
  • Extra Benefits: Dental, vision, hearing, fitness programs, and other benefits offered by Medicare Advantage plans.

Medicare Annual Review and Switching Plans
The Medicare annual enrollment period dates (AEP) are a crucial time for a Medicare annual review. This is when you can switch Medicare plans, including moving from Original Medicare to Medicare Advantage, changing Medigap policies (though medical underwriting may apply after your initial enrollment period for Medigap), or switching Part D plans.
